Node Js
Vue.js
fullstack
Graphql
Full time
Hiring 3 people
8 years of experience
Ho Chi Minh
Published 04/05/2024

Job Description

About the Role

As the Lead FullStack Engineer, you'll spearhead the technical strategy and execution of our state-of-the-art insurance enterprise software solutions. You will lead and mentor a dynamic team of engineers, driving the development, design, and ongoing enhancement of our SaaS platform. By working closely with stakeholders and harnessing cutting-edge technologies, you'll play a critical role in architecting scalable solutions and delivering exceptional quality software.

What You Will Do

  • Direct the entire development lifecycle of our SaaS platform, from conception through deployment to ongoing maintenance, aligning with both business goals and technical specifications.
  • Offer technical leadership and mentorship to a team of Full Stack Engineers, promoting professional growth and fostering a collaborative environment through regular coaching and knowledge sharing.
  • Work closely with product managers, designers, and other stakeholders to transform business needs into robust technical solutions, prioritizing tasks based on impact and feasibility.
  • Lead architectural discussions, define coding standards, and establish best practices to ensure platform scalability, reliability, and maintainability.
  • Conduct comprehensive code reviews, uphold quality standards, and advocate for continuous enhancement through effective testing methodologies and automation.
  • Identify and address technical debt and scalability challenges, spearheading initiatives to boost system performance and efficiency.
  • Lead security and compliance efforts, ensuring strict adherence to industry standards and implementing robust security protocols.
  • Keep abreast of the latest industry trends and technologies, assessing their applicability to our platform and promoting innovative practices within the team.

What We Need

  • Proven leadership experience in a technical role with a strong track record of guiding engineering teams in developing complex SaaS solutions.
  • At least 8 years of hands-on experience in Full Stack development, with proficiency in technologies like Node.js, Vue.js, GraphQL, MongoDB, Docker, and TypeScript.
  • Expertise in major cloud platforms such as AWS, Azure, or Google Cloud, with skills in architecting and deploying resilient, scalable applications.
  • A deep understanding of Test-Driven Development (TDD), comprehensive testing practices, and experience with automated testing tools.
  • Strong command of Object-Oriented Programming, SOLID principles, and design patterns.
  • Knowledge of web security protocols, with practical experience in implementing security measures and compliance with regulatory standards.
  • Experience with Docker and cloud infrastructure solutions; familiarity with Nest.js is a plus.
  • Exceptional communication and interpersonal skills, capable of effectively collaborating with and influencing cross-functional teams and stakeholders.
  • Ability to manage multiple projects simultaneously, with a proactive and results-driven approach to challenges.
  • A passion for continuous learning and staying updated with the latest technologies and industry developments.

Skills

Node Js
Vue.js
fullstack
Graphql

Benefits

Why Join Us?

Joining our team means becoming part of a mission-driven group that is dedicated to transforming the insurance industry. We offer a stimulating work environment where innovation and diversity are valued, and where your work directly contributes to our global impact. Enjoy the flexibility of remote work, coupled with the camaraderie of an inclusive and dynamic team.

  • Flexible Leave Policy: Take time off when you need it with our flexible leave policy.
  • Diverse Team: Thrive in an international environment with colleagues from diverse backgrounds.
  • Competitive Compensation: Receive a competitive salary package, including performance bonuses and stock options after six months.
  • Career Growth: Benefit from tailored learning and development plans to ensure your professional growth.
  • Company Culture: Enjoy a variety of company activities and events that foster a strong team spirit.
  • Embark on a fulfilling career path where innovation, collaboration, and employee growth are valued and encouraged. Join us in transforming the insurance software industry, one solution at a time.
  • Bonus: performance bonus, stock option after 6 months,
  • Heath insurance
  • Probation: 2 months (100% salary)
  • Compulsory insurances are based on full salary

Career

Company Info

freeC
Ho Chi Minh
101-300 employees

About

freeC is the Smart Recruiting Platform that leverages matching technology to actively connect hundred of thousand of employers and job seekers. The success of freeC is determined by our success in operating as a unified team. If you're interesting, ambitious, and eager to advance your career with us, explore our vacancies as below. We're excited to have you on board our ship to help us grow fast, deliver on our mission of actively connecting employers and job seekers around Vietnam

Working Address

Lầu 06, Tòa nhà BCONS TOWER II , Số 42/1, Đường Ung Văn Khiêm, Phường 25, Quận Bình Thạnh, TP. HCMView map